Ingredients
Main Ingredients Needed
To make herb-crusted tilapia, you'll need:
- 4 tilapia fillets
- 1 cup fresh breadcrumbs
- 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 2 tablespoons fresh parsley, finely chopped
- 1 tablespoon fresh basil, finely chopped
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on onion powder
- 1/2 teaspoon sea salt
- 1/4 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
- 1/4 cup Dijon mustard
- 2 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il
- Lemon wedges, for serving

Step-by-Step Instructions
Preparation and Preheat the Oven
Start by preheating your oven to 400°F (200°C). This heat helps the fish cook well and form a golden crust. While the oven warms, gather your ingredients. You will need tilapia fillets, fresh breadcrumbs, and herbs.
Mixing the Herb-Breadcrumb Coating
In a medium bowl, mix the fresh breadcrumbs with Parmesan cheese. Add the chopped parsley, chopped basil, garlic powder, onion powder, sea salt, and black pepper. Stir until everything blends well. This mixture will be the tasty crust for your fish.
Coating the Tilapia Fillets
Next, take the tilapia fillets and pat them dry with paper towels. This step helps the mustard stick. Brush a thin layer of Dijon mustard on each side of the fillets. Then, take your herb-breadcrumb mixture and press it onto the top of each fillet. Make sure every fillet gets a nice, even coat.
Baking the Tilapia
Now, lightly grease a baking sheet with olive oil or cooking spray. Place the coated tilapia fillets on it. Drizzle a small amount of olive oil over the tops of the fillets. This will help them brown nicely. Bake the fillets in the oven for 12-15 minutes. They are done when they flake easily with a fork and look golden brown.
Serving Suggestions
Once baked, take the tilapia out of the oven and let it rest for a minute. This keeps the fish moist. Serve the fillets hot with lemon wedges on the side. The lemon adds a bright flavor that pairs well with the fish. For a nice touch, garnish with extra chopped herbs and lemon slices. Enjoy your meal!
Tips & Tricks
Best Practices for Cooking Tilapia
To cook tilapia well, start with fresh fish. Fresh fillets taste better and have a firmer texture. Pat the fillets dry before cooking. This helps the mustard and crust stick. Always preheat your oven to 400°F. This ensures even cooking and a nice crust.
How to Achieve a Crispy Herb Crust
To get a crispy herb crust, use fresh breadcrumbs. They hold moisture and add great texture. Mix the breadcrumbs with Parmesan, herbs, and spices in a bowl. Press the mixture firmly onto the fish. This creates a thick layer that crisps up beautifully. Drizzle a bit of olive oil on top before baking. This extra fat helps the crust brown.
Pairing with Side Dishes
For a balanced meal, pair tilapia with simple sides. Roasted vegetables like asparagus or broccoli complement the fish. A fresh salad adds color and crunch. You can also serve it with rice or quinoa for a filling option. Don't forget lemon wedges for a bright finish. The citrus brightens the dish and enhances the flavors.

Variations
Alternative Herb Combinations
You can change the herbs in this recipe. Try using thyme, dill, or oregano. Each herb brings a unique flavor. For a spicy kick, add some crushed red pepper flakes. Mix and match herbs to find your favorite blend.
Different Types of Fish to Use
While tilapia is great, you can use other fish too. Cod, haddock, or even salmon work well. Each fish has its own taste and texture. Just adjust the cooking time based on the thickness of the fish.
Gluten-Free Options for Breadcrumbs
If you need a gluten-free option, use gluten-free breadcrumbs. You can also crush gluten-free crackers. Almond flour is another good choice for a nutty flavor. These options keep the crust crispy and tasty.
Storage Info
How to Store Leftovers
Store leftover herb-crusted tilapia fillets in an airtight container. Keep them in the fridge. They will stay fresh for up to three days. Make sure the fillets cool down before sealing them. This helps keep the crust crispy.
Reheating Tips for Optimal Flavor
To reheat your tilapia fillets, use the oven for the best results.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C). Place the tilapia on a baking sheet. Cover it with foil to keep moisture in. Heat for about 10 minutes. Check that it's warm throughout before serving.
Freezing Instructions
If you want to freeze the tilapia, wrap each fillet in plastic wrap tightly. Place the wrapped fillets in a freezer bag. Remove as much air as possible. You can freeze them for up to two months. When ready to eat, thaw them in the fridge overnight before reheating.
FAQs
How long to bake tilapia fillets?
Bake tilapia fillets for 12 to 15 minutes. This time ensures they cook through and stay tender. The fish should flake easily with a fork when done.
Can I use dried herbs instead of fresh?
Yes, you can use dried herbs. However, fresh herbs add more flavor and color. If using dried herbs, use one-third the amount. This way, you still get a tasty crust.
What to serve with herb-crusted tilapia?
Herb-crusted tilapia pairs well with many sides. Try roasted vegetables, rice, or a fresh green salad. Lemon wedges are great for a zesty touch. You can also serve it with quinoa for extra protein.
Is tilapia a healthy fish choice?
Tilapia is a healthy choice. It is low in calories and high in protein. This fish also contains omega-3 fatty acids, which are good for your heart. Just be sure to source your tilapia from a trustworthy supplier.
How can I tell if tilapia is cooked properly?
Check if tilapia is cooked by looking for its color and texture. Cooked tilapia turns white and opaque. You can also poke it with a fork; it should flake easily. If it’s still translucent or hard, it needs more time.
